Output ecbd86b3df54e7382f8defa04674884e71a0bd92e6b03ecd140aa2c8a0898fdc:0

value
23901403
script pubkey
OP_0 OP_PUSHBYTES_20 ce5a1cd6f2d0e16f94f14e0e3b4469e5015d9823
address
bc1qeedpe4hj6rskl983fc8rk3rfu5q4mxprql25qm
transaction
ecbd86b3df54e7382f8defa04674884e71a0bd92e6b03ecd140aa2c8a0898fdc
confirmations
20480
spent
true